Definition
A sequence transduction model is a type of machine learning model that transforms input sequences into output sequences, often used in tasks like translation and speech recognition.
Summary
Sequence transduction models are essential in the field of machine learning, particularly for tasks involving sequential data such as language translation and speech recognition. These models take an input sequence and transform it into an output sequence, leveraging architectures like Recurrent Neural Networks (RNNs) and attention mechanisms to improve performance. Understanding these models requires a grasp of sequences, neural networks, and the specific challenges associated with processing sequential data. As technology advances, the importance of sequence transduction models continues to grow, with applications spanning various industries. By mastering these concepts, learners can contribute to innovative solutions in natural language processing, machine translation, and beyond. This knowledge not only enhances technical skills but also opens doors to exciting career opportunities in artificial intelligence and data science.
Key Takeaways
Importance of Sequences
Sequences are fundamental in many machine learning tasks, especially in natural language processing.
highRole of RNNs
RNNs are crucial for handling sequential data, but they have limitations that newer models address.
mediumAttention Mechanism
The attention mechanism allows models to focus on relevant parts of the input sequence, improving accuracy.
highPractical Applications
Sequence transduction models are widely used in real-world applications like translation and speech recognition.
mediumWhat to Learn Next
Natural Language Processing
Understanding NLP is crucial as it encompasses many applications of sequence transduction models.
intermediateDeep Learning
Deep learning techniques are foundational for advanced sequence models and their applications.
advanced